Cable Internet Providers and Services

Cable broadband internet services use a cable TV connection to furnish users with high speed internet access. To enable the link there's a cable modem at the users side and a cable modem termination system on the cable operator's side. The length from the termination system and modem can be close to one hundred miles with zero challenges taking place.

Cable high speed internet can perform at about 30 Mbps, interestingly particular cable modems could possibly control the level of information getting transmitted. In addition, when using cable high speed internet services you share data transfer useage with other users. The network monitor makes sure that bandwidth is dispersed proficiently to make certain service will not become sluggish during hours whenever overall consumption hits higher levels.

There are manyservice provider options for cable high speed internet. Cox Communications, Comcast and Time Warner Cable are major cable ISPs in the bulk of the Us.

DSL High speed internet Services

Digital Subscriber Line (DSL) broadband internet services transmit information with a copper phone line. Unlike dial-up solutions, DSL functions on frequencies which are not intended for to establish telephone calls by dividing the line into two - one for calls and the second for internet usage.

Digital customer lines move from a large centralized location along to users. This typically limits DSL delivery to a modest length of 2 miles from the central location, though a few lines go up to five miles long. This issue additionally has an effect on the exact upload and download speeds.

The great news is that little to no infrastructure is involved and it is a genuine broadband internet service that transmits data at a rate as much as 10Mbps. DSL may also deliver better security and dependability than other options since it's being supplied by a phone line which typically is not shared.

Satellite Internet Services and Providers

Satellite high speed internet services utilize orbiting satellites to record and transfer broadband data between a satellite provider and it's customers. Though the upload and download speeds measure up as broadband, because data must journey to the satellite and back over many miles users could experience signal delays around 1-2 seconds.

Regardless of the possibility of brief delays, satellite broadband internet is able to deliver data at 5Mbps. Satellite high speed internet is ideal for those wanting broadband internet in remote places where other internet services aren't available.

Fiber Optic High speed internet Options and Providers

Fiber Optic is the most recent and fastest way to carry internet into the home. Networks of fiber optic cables can supply internet up to twenty five times faster than other high-speed options and provide an exceptionally dependable internet connection. This is due to the fact that fiber optic wiring is a lot more strong than other connections and is not troubled by static, noise or storms.

For those in search of the fastest broadband internet access fiber optic is the best option. Fiber optic networks are famous for their ability to transfer data at rates as much as 50 Mbps. Presently, AT&T and Comcast provide fiber optic/copper hybrid services but 100 percent fiber optic broadband internet services are available solely through Verizon FiOS. They began supplying fiber optic high speed internet services in 2006 and are continuously increasing their service areas.
